This Bachelor of Arts program provides students with comprehensive training in various dance styles such as ballet, modern, tap, and jazz, combined with business education. The curriculum covers essential subjects like choreography, dance history, teaching methods, and movement analysis. Graduates are equipped for careers in dance studio ownership, advanced studies in dance-related disciplines including arts management, dance therapy, or cultural dance studies, as well as private instruction roles.

Initial acceptance into the dance program requires an audition, with first-year students entering as provisional majors. Progress through technique levels demands consistent achievement - students must earn at least a B grade for one semester to advance between Ballet IV through VIII, and maintain similar standards in other technique courses.

Full admission to the BA Dance program within the School of Dance, Theatre and Arts Administration requires successful completion of the provisional year, positive work ethic evaluation, passing the Freshman Jury and Interview, and maintaining a 2.785 GPA in dance courses. Continuous technique class enrollment is mandatory until requirements are fulfilled, including two semesters of Ballet V for the Dance Studies with Business Cognate specialization.

Official documents (including transcripts, test results, and diplomas/certificates) MUST be submitted for full admission, award of scholarships and the issuance of an I-20.
You are a high school student or have completed high school or equivalent and have never enrolled in a college/university.
An official final transcript must be submitted before you can register for your second semester coursework.
SAT or ACT The University of Akron is test-optional. The SAT or ACT is not required for admission or scholarship consideration for applicants.
